Description:

A tour-de-force by the acclaimed jazz pianist Laurent de Wilde, Monk is a personal, anecdotal biography of one of the greatest, most controversial pianists/composers in modern music. Laurent has captured the everydayness of Monk, his bearing, his eccentricities, his stubbornness and isolation, and the narrow circle of women around him. Laurent writes of Monk's distinctive fingering, of his producers, engineers and agents, of money and tours, of the importance of the rhythm section, of saxophones, drugs, and Pannonica, of Nellie, and of madness.
